ConfirmSignUpRequest

Represents the request to confirm registration of a user.

Properties

Link copied to clipboard

Information that supports analytics outcomes with Amazon Pinpoint, including the user's endpoint ID. The endpoint ID is a destination for Amazon Pinpoint push notifications, for example a device identifier, email address, or phone number.

Link copied to clipboard

The ID of the app client associated with the user pool.

Link copied to clipboard

A map of custom key-value pairs that you can provide as input for any custom workflows that this action triggers.

Link copied to clipboard

The confirmation code that your user pool sent in response to the SignUp request.

Link copied to clipboard

When true, forces user confirmation despite any existing aliases. Defaults to false. A value of true migrates the alias from an existing user to the new user if an existing user already has the phone number or email address as an alias.

Link copied to clipboard

A keyed-hash message authentication code (HMAC) calculated using the secret key of a user pool client and username plus the client ID in the message. For more information about SecretHash, see Computing secret hash values.

Link copied to clipboard

The optional session ID from a SignUp API request. You can sign in a user directly from the sign-up process with the USER_AUTH authentication flow.

Link copied to clipboard

Contextual data about your user session like the device fingerprint, IP address, or location. Amazon Cognito threat protection evaluates the risk of an authentication event based on the context that your app generates and passes to Amazon Cognito when it makes API requests.

Link copied to clipboard

The name of the user that you want to query or modify. The value of this parameter is typically your user's username, but it can be any of their alias attributes. If username isn't an alias attribute in your user pool, this value must be the sub of a local user or the username of a user from a third-party IdP.
